    Abstract: A cap for a container can be inserted into the mouth of the container and the pressure which it exerts against the mouth can be controlled by rotating the cap's knob in either circumferential direction. The cap includes a nut with grooves which can move up and down the axial direction within a guide member included in the cap. The guide member includes several prongs which engage the nut grooves and which expand and contract as the nut travels up and down the tapered inner surface of the guide. The cap further includes a plug whose outer surface is in contact with the mouth of the container and whose inner surface houses the guide member. As the prongs expand and contract they increase and decrease the radial pressure caused by the plug against the mouth of the container.

    Abstract: A dosing device for dispensing liquid from a container (1) in which flow through flow openings (23) to an outlet tube (44) is blocked after controlled delay by an obturator (3) moveable within a control chamber (2) mounted in a container neck (101) behind the outlet tube (44). Movement of the obturator (3) is governed by restricted flow through control openings (28) at the rear of the control chamber. Restoration of the obturator to the back of the control chamber facilitates repeated dosing. An elastomeric element (6) of resiliently deformable material promotes a seal to achieve a cleanly defined dose. In one proposal the elastomeric element coats the surface of the obturator and/or the outlet tube (64) to cut off the flow. Another proposal provides a one-way elastomeric valve element (63) for blocking the flow openings to enable rapid recovery after a dosing operation.

    Abstract: An enhanced multipurpose twist tie is formed with two helically disposed wires encased in a sheath having a polygon shaped cross section, a longitudinal ridges, and detachable end caps. The wires are defined by a longitudinal length and a pair of wire termini. The wires intertwine in a helical configuration along the length of the sheath. The helical configuration compresses the wires together and also allows for a greater concentration of wire to be fit into the sheath. The sheath is defined by an outer face having a plurality of longitudinal ridges that extend along the length of the sheath to provide a grip for facilitated twisting and tying of the twist tie. An inner face has a polygon shaped cross section that restricts longitudinal and rotational slippage by the wires. The end caps detachably attach at sheath termini to form a smooth surface over wire termini.

    Abstract: A method for packaging bone-in meat products using a self-adhesive bone cover wrap includes impregnating a non-woven polypropylene layer with a wax formulation. Microcrystalline wax, propylene glycol, and paraffin wax are combined to create the wax formulation. The self-adhesive bone cover wrap is particularly suitable for covering bone-in meat products including covering outwardly extending bones with the non-woven polypropylene layer precluding puncture of the bone cover wrap by the bones and self-adhering to itself to seal the meat product within.

According to the invention, straw or hay or a mixture of the two is plasticized; the plasticized straw and/or hay is subjected to moulding; while maintaining the moulding, the plasticization is reversed and the straw and/or hay is hardened without material bonding between the individual stalks of straw and/or hay; and the straw and/or hay is provided with a coating on all sides.

Upper portions of the sidewalls extend upward beyond the usable space to form a hem. Lift loops that enable the large container to be lifted by mechanical means are sewn onto the hem. Thus, the usable space remains stitchless, i.e., without stitch holes, yet the lift loops are stitched to the hem.
